Consider orientation: large south-facing glazing can bring in natural light, however excessive solar gain will lead to summer overheating so shading should be considered.
Insulation – Keep heat where you want it.
Insulation reduces heat flow through walls, ceiling and the floor.
It soaks up warmth in winter; it helps maintain the room cold.
In summers, it helps to keep the heat out.
And the constant is continuity: if there are gaps in all of those locations around eaves, dormers, and intersections, there will be cold spots or worse.
Venting – Fresh air without cooling
Even in your well insulated home you must control that air flow.
Extraction systems in the kitchen and bathroom.
Background ventilation (trickle vents).
During larger renovations, MVHR (mechanical ventilation with heat recovery) can be used to bring in fresh air instead of allowing it through windows and seals keeping much more warmth inside the building.
